- Abstract: Background and Aims: A recognized non-invasive biomarker to improve risk stratification of IgA nephropathy (IgAN) patients is scarce. CXCL16 has been shown to play a key role in inflammatory disease as chemoattractant, adhesion and fibrosis factor. This study assessed the possibility of plasma CXCL16 as a potential biomarker in IgAN patients. Method: Plasma CXCL16 was measured in 230 patients with renal biopsied IgAN from 2012 to 2014. The patients were followed for 41.3 months with 50% reduction in eGFR or ESRD as end-points. Results: The plasma CXCL16 levels in IgAN patients were significantly correlated with the uric acid, estimated glomerular filtration rate and tubular atrophy/interstitial fibrosis score in multivariate analysis. In addition, the counts of CD4+ T cells, CD8+ T cells and CD20+ B cells in renal biopsies of IgAN patients were significantly correlated with the plasma CXCL16 levels, but not CD68+ macrophage. Finally, we concluded that patients with higher plasma CXCL16 levels had a higher risk of poor renal outcome compared with those with lower. No association was observed between the CXCL16 polymorphisms and clinical parameters including plasma CXCL16 levels and prognosis. Conclusion: Plasma CXCL16 levels were associated with clinical parameters, pathological damage, the CD4+ T cells, CD8+ T cells and CD20+ B cells infiltration in renal tissue and renal outcome in IgAN patients.
